New bimetallic complexes of the composition MHg(CHNO)(SCN) have been synthesized, where M = Mn (I), Fe (II), Cd (III); CHNO is nicotinamide (NA). The compounds were obtained from aqueous solutions and studied by CHNS/O analysis, IR spectroscopy, inductively coupled plasma optical emission spectrometry (ICP-OES) and X-ray diffraction analysis (XRD). Compounds I–III are isostructural and crystallize in the monoclinic syngony (space group C2/c). The coordination environment of the M atom is formed by two donor nitrogen atoms of two monodentately coordinated NA and four nitrogen atoms of the SCN groups, which form bridges between the M and Hg ions, connecting them into a three-dimensional framework. Hg ions have a tetrahedral coordination environment consisting of four S atoms of four SCN groups.
